The Dynamics of Rivalry: Beyond the Pitch
The rivalry between Real Madrid and Lionel Messi extends far beyond the green expanse of the football pitch. It is rooted in decades of competition, each chapter etching its mark on the annals of sporting history. From the days of Alfredo Di Stéfano to the modern era of Cristiano Ronaldo, the Madrid-Barcelona rivalry has been synonymous with passion and fervor. Messi's pivotal role in Barcelona's success has only heightened the intensity of this rivalry, transforming him into a symbolic figure embodying the hopes and dreams of millions of Culés worldwide.
